About the event

Volunteers will be helping finish the re-route of the Middle Fork Trail. This will involve clearing brush, removing overburden to get to mineral soil and then creating the trail itself. Volunteers will help with a variety of tasks for the trail construction and will be using hand tools to do the construction. Once work is complete for the day, we will head to Midnight Sun Brewing for a volunteer social with free beer. 

HIKING INFO:

This is a long and strenuous hike. The project site is roughly equidistant from both the Glen Alps trailhead and Prospect Heights. Volunteers will need to hike in with their tools and, importantly, will make the same hard hike out at the end of the day.
